What is I Love Lund AB LT-Debt-to-Total-Asset?

I Love Lund AB XSAT:LOVE B +4.37% 22 LT-Debt-to-Total-Asset is 0.00 as of Jun. 2026. GuruFocus rates XSAT:LOVE B with a GF Score™ of 22/100.

LT Debt to Total Assets is a measurement representing the percentage of a corporation's assets that are financed with loans and financial obligations lasting more than one year. The ratio provides a general measure of the financial position of a company, including its ability to meet financial requirements for outstanding loans. It is calculated as a company's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ligationdivide by its Total Assets. I Love Lund AB's long-term debt to total assests ratio for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 was 0.00.

I Love Lund AB's long-term debt to total assets ratio stayed the same from Jun. 2025 (0.00) to Jun. 2026 (0.00).

I Love Lund AB LT-Debt-to-Total-Asset Calculation

I Love Lund AB's Long-Term Debt to Total Asset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

LT Debt to Total Assets (A: Dec. 2025 )=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ation (A: Dec. 2025 )/Total Assets (A: Dec. 2025 )
=0/35.744
=0.00

I Love Lund AB's Long-Term Debt to Total Asset Ratio for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

LT Debt to Total Assets (Q: Jun. 2026 )=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ation (Q: Jun. 2026 )/Total Assets (Q: Jun. 2026 )
=0/35.87
=0.00

I Love Lund AB Business Description

Address Hospitalsgatan 2, Lund, SWE, 223 53
I Love Lund AB is an investment company that invests in companies based in Lund. It invests broadly across all sectors and with the main focus on pre-seed companies. The portfolio's return objective is to achieve a return over a business cycle that is as good as equivalent references.
